As I created my first doll I felt myself transported to this very quiet, calm and confident place and knew that my own artistic expression had been born.  The dolls that I make are considered impressionistic in that they are not meant to be exact representations of a particular culture. Instead, they are meant to give the viewer the impression of a culture. The textiles that I utilize for a doll embodying a particular ethnic group often originate in the area of the world being represented. However, I have found that textiles produced in different parts of the world are often quite similar.

Therefore, I can use the same textiles to portray several ethnic groups.  Typically I create dolls from Third World countries as the textures and colors of their textiles, the design of their clothing, as well as the jewelry, headdresses and other exquisite adornments appeal to my artistic sense. It is my aspiration that as you observe these art dolls, you are transported to a variety of diverse cultures.
